Description

The Knightsbridge 20AX intermediate grid module is a single-width switch module in polished chrome, designed to clip into Knightsbridge grid mounting frames (sold separately). The module provides intermediate switching function, used in three-way or multi-location lighting control where a circuit is controlled from three or more points.

Intermediate modules are typically installed between two two-way switches to create a three-location switching setup, allowing a single lighting circuit to be controlled from an entrance, hallway and landing, for example. The 20AX rating handles resistive loads up to 4,600W on 230V supply, suitable for controlling multiple light fittings on a single circuit or higher-wattage downlight arrays.

The polished chrome rocker sits in a white ABS and steel module body measuring 24.8mm wide by 56.3mm tall, fitting a single grid aperture. The module clips into the front of a grid frame without tools, and the frame itself fixes to a standard 35mm minimum back box. Frequently Asked

What is an intermediate switch used for?

An intermediate switch is used in three-way or multi-location lighting control. It sits between two two-way switches, allowing a single lighting circuit to be controlled from three or more positions. Typical use is controlling landing lights from ground floor, first floor and top floor in a multi-storey home.

Does this include the mounting frame?

No. The module clips into a Knightsbridge grid mounting frame, which is sold separately. Frames are available in 1-gang, 2-gang, 3-gang and larger configurations to hold multiple modules in a single faceplate.

What back box depth is required?

A 35mm minimum back box depth is required for safe installation. The module itself has an 18.7mm recessed depth and 7mm projection from the frame once fitted.
